Output 7aed307e9872076612909a31e28cf8c03ffbf476123ea409ab270de1e7d66932:0

value
522427
script pubkey
OP_0 OP_PUSHBYTES_20 ddf7599edd5931c5951d41f32d37973141188c95
address
bc1qmhm4n8katycut9gag8ej6duhx9q33ry4ugzg82
transaction
7aed307e9872076612909a31e28cf8c03ffbf476123ea409ab270de1e7d66932
spent
true